A Clash Between Federal and Local Authority:
The conflict centers on the differing approaches to immigration enforcement between the federal government and numerous local jurisdictions. Sanctuary cities, often governed by Democrats, have policies that limit cooperation with federal immigration agencies. These policies often restrict local law enforcement from inquiring about the immigration status of individuals during routine interactions and refrain from holding individuals solely for ICE detainers. The Trump administration views these policies as obstacles to its immigration enforcement efforts, leading to increased ICE activity in these areas.
Increased ICE Raids and Deportations:
Reports indicate a marked increase in ICE raids and deportations in sanctuary cities since the Trump administration took office. These actions have targeted individuals with prior criminal convictions, but also those without criminal records, highlighting a broader enforcement strategy. The increased presence of ICE agents in these cities has created fear and uncertainty within immigrant communities, discouraging individuals from reporting crimes or seeking essential services for fear of deportation. This erosion of trust between immigrant communities and local authorities undermines public safety and social cohesion.
